The Four Waterfalls

  1. Sgwd Clun-Gwyn
    The walk begins with sweeping views over this powerful, two-tiered waterfall. Here your guide will introduce the geology of the area—carved over millions of years—and explain how the River Mellte has shaped this dramatic landscape.

  2. Sgwd Isaf Clun-Gwyn
    Descending deeper into Waterfall Country, you’ll reach this beautifully layered cascade. Your guide will share stories of local mining heritage, the old drovers who once navigated these valleys, and how this region became a treasured part of Welsh natural history.

  3. Sgwd y Pannwr
    A quieter, more secluded waterfall, Sgwd y Pannwr is known for its swirling pools and enchanting forest setting. This is where visitors often pause to immerse themselves in the peaceful atmosphere while the guide highlights the unique flora and fauna that thrive in these wet woodlands.

  4. Sgwd yr Eira – The Waterfall You Can Walk Behind
    The showstopper. This iconic curtain of water allows you to walk behind its thundering sheet—a moment that belongs on every adventurer’s bucket list. Your guide will ensure safe passage along the rocky path and share the folklore and myths that surround this magical place.
